操作系统必须完成的工作
-
管理计算机系统的资源,包括处理器、内存、I/O设备等。
-
提供用户和应用程序的交互界面,使其能够进行输入输出操作。
-
调度和管理各种程序和进程,确保它们按照指定的优先级和规则运行,避免冲突和资源竞争。
-
提供数据和程序存储的管理,保证数据的安全性和完整性。
-
提供错误检测和容错机制,保证系统的稳定性和可靠性。
-
提供系统安全性管理,保护系统和用户的数据免受未经授权的访问。
-
提供网络和通信管理,支持多个计算机之间的数据交换和共享。
-
提供系统的备份和恢复机制,以便在系统出现故障时能够快速恢复数据和程序。
原文地址: https://www.cveoy.top/t/topic/fNZb 著作权归作者所有。请勿转载和采集!